Do you have a gifted child?

Consider connecting with others at the next GiftedNYS Meetup

Posted

ONLINE — GiftedNYS Meet Ups aim to create an inclusive community of New Yorkers who know their gifted learners deserve equitable opportunities to excel. 

If you are concerned about the academic, social, and emotional needs of your student, join fellow families and educators for GiftedNYS' May Meet Up.

It’ll be held on Tuesday, May 14 from 7 p.m. to 8 p.m. online.

Meet the facilitators

Samantha Gabrielli has over a decade of advocacy and K-12 classroom teaching experience in charter, public and independent education systems. She’s passionate about using curricular design and differentiation to create safe, joyous and challenging learning spaces for asynchronous learners.

Crystal Kaczmarek-Bogner has two teens with gifted education needs. Utilizing her extensive group facilitation experience, she established a district-level networking group for parents of gifted students which she led for three years. More recently, she has been advocating for equitable gifted education at the state level.

Gifted New York State, Inc. is a not-for-profit organization of parents, educators and professionals who have come together to support the needs of New York’s gifted and twice-exceptional (2E) student population and their families.​
